I took the plunge and bought the Giant Super Sportster. I didn't get the engine, as I thniking that the Zenoah may be a better choice than the Fuji, (according to the Gas Engine Fourm).
The airplane calls for a 1.2 to 2.0 2 or 4 stroke, or 2.0 gas. Tower packages it with a Fuji 32 which just happens to fit the specs.
My question is just what are the equivalents? This will be my first gasser; I've flown nothing but 2/4 stroke glow. With glow, I've always been under the impression that 2 stroke puts out more power that 4 stroke for equal displacement. Why does GP recommend the same size range for 2/4 stroke?
Where will a 2.0 gas fit in to the range? Do they put out power equal to a 2 or 4 stroke? I'm tending toward the Zenoah G38 at this time, but I've got plenty of time to decide and I'd appreciate input!
